Step 2: Volatility Understanding

Game volatility affects the player experience and potential payouts:

  • NetEnt: Generally offers a mix of low, medium, and high volatility games. For instance:
    • Low Volatility: Starburst (RTP: 96.1%)
    • High Volatility: Dead or Alive II (RTP: 96.8%)
  • Microgaming: Also provides a variety of volatility levels. Examples include:
    • Low Volatility: Thunderstruck II (RTP: 96.65%)
    • High Volatility: Mega Moolah (RTP: 88.12%)

Step 4: Comparing Key Metrics

Feature NetEnt Microgaming
Number of Games 200+ 1,200+
Typical RTP 96.5% 96.3%
Volatility Levels Low, Medium, High Low, Medium, High
Technological Platform HTML5 Proprietary Software
